DWR is easy Ajax for Java. It makes it simple to call Java code directly from Javascript.
It gets rid of almost all the boiler plate code between the web browser and your Java code.

package org.directwebremoting.dwrp;
import java.util.Map;
import javax.servlet.http.HttpServletRequest;
import org.directwebremoting.WebContext;
import org.directwebremoting.WebContextFactory;
import org.directwebremoting.extend.PageNormalizer;
import org.directwebremoting.extend.RealScriptSession;
import org.directwebremoting.extend.ServerException;
import org.directwebremoting.util.Messages;
/**
* A container for the information passed in by an Poll request
* @author Joe Walker [joe at getahead dot ltd dot uk]
*/
public class PollBatch
{
/**
* @param request
* @param pageNormalizer
* @throws ServerException
*/
public PollBatch(HttpServletRequest request, PageNormalizer pageNormalizer) throws ServerException
{
debug = request.getHeader("User-Agent");
get = "GET".equals(request.getMethod());
Map parameters = null;
if (get)
{
parameters = ParseUtil.parseGet(request);
}
else
{
parameters = ParseUtil.parsePost(request);
}
batchId = extractParameter(parameters, ProtocolConstants.INBOUND_KEY_BATCHID);
scriptId = extractParameter(parameters, ProtocolConstants.INBOUND_KEY_SCRIPT_SESSIONID);
httpSessionId = extractParameter(parameters, ProtocolConstants.INBOUND_KEY_HTTP_SESSIONID);
String page = extractParameter(parameters, ProtocolConstants.INBOUND_KEY_PAGE);
String prString = extractParameter(parameters, ProtocolConstants.INBOUND_KEY_PARTIAL_RESPONSE);
partialResponse = PartialResponse.fromOrdinal(prString);
// We must parse the parameters before we setup the conduit because it's
// only after doing this that we know the scriptSessionId
WebContext webContext = WebContextFactory.get();
// Various bits of parseResponse need to be stashed away places
String normalizedPage = pageNormalizer.normalizePage(page);
webContext.setCurrentPageInformation(normalizedPage, scriptId);
scriptSession = (RealScriptSession) webContext.getScriptSession();
}
/**
* Extract a parameter and ensure it is in the request.
* This is needed to cope with Jetty continuations that are not real
* continuations.
* @param parameters The parameter list parsed out of the request
* @param paramName The name of the parameter sent
* @return The found value
*/
protected String extractParameter(Map parameters, String paramName)
{
String id = (String) parameters.remove(paramName);
if (id == null)
{
throw new IllegalArgumentException(Messages.getString("PollHandler.MissingParameter", paramName));
}
return id;
}
